发明名称 Refrigeration cycle apparatus
摘要 A refrigeration cycle apparatus includes a controller configured to control opening and closing of a solenoid valve and that of a solenoid valve depending on any of a time when a compressor is activated, a time when the compressor is in normal operation, a time when a temperature of a motor of the compressor rises in the normal operation, and a time when the compressor stopped due to low-pressure cutoff is activated.

主权项 1. A refrigeration cycle apparatus comprising: a heat source side circuit in which at least one compressor configured to compress a refrigerant and discharge the refrigerant, a condenser configured to exchange heat between the refrigerant discharged from the compressor and a heat medium, and a subcooling coil configured to subcool the refrigerant flowing from the condenser are connected by pipes; an injection circuit that branches off at a downstream side of the subcooling coil in the heat source circuit and connects through the subcooling coil to an intermediate pressure portion of the compressor; a bypass that branches off at a downstream side of the subcooling coil in the injection circuit and connects to a suction side of the compressor; a first solenoid valve disposed closer to the compressor than a connection point between the injection circuit and the bypass; a second solenoid valve disposed in the bypass; and a controller configured to control a frequency of the compressor, opening and closing of the first solenoid valve, and opening and closing of the second solenoid valve,wherein the controller controls the opening and closing of the first and second solenoid valves depending on any of a time when the compressor is activated, a time when the compressor is in normal operation, a time when a temperature of a motor of the compressor rises in the normal operation, or a time when the compressor is reactivated so as to return from a stopped state due to low-pressure cutoff,the controller is configured to (i) control both of the first solenoid valve and the second solenoid valve to remain in a closed position during a first time, the first time being when the compressor is in the stopped state due to low-pressure cutoff; and (ii) control the first solenoid valve to be opened from the closed position and the second solenoid valve to remain in the closed position during a second time, the second time being when the compressor is reactivated so as to return from the stopped state due to low-pressure cutoff.
